What is a Remote 3D Inventor?

A Remote 3D Inventor is a professional who designs and creates three-dimensional models, prototypes, or products using specialized CAD (Computer-Aided Design) software like Autodesk Inventor, while working from a remote location rather than an on-site office. They collaborate with clients, engineers, and other team members online to develop, refine, and finalize 3D designs for a variety of industries such as manufacturing, engineering, product design, and architecture. Remote 3D Inventors must have strong technical skills, creativity, and the ability to communicate effectively in a virtual work environment.

What are some common challenges faced by Remote 3D Inventors, and how can they be overcome?

Remote 3D Inventors often encounter challenges related to communication and collaboration, especially when working with cross-functional teams such as engineers, designers, or project managers who may be in different time zones. Ensuring that 3D models and design files are accurately shared and reviewed can require excellent documentation and version control practices. To overcome these hurdles, leveraging cloud-based collaboration tools, scheduling regular video meetings, and maintaining clear project documentation are essential. Staying proactive in communication helps minimize misunderstandings and keeps projects on track.
